2 Samuel 8

KJ3 Literal Translation — Chapter 8 of 24

1 And it happened afterward, David struck the Philistines, and humbled them. And David took the Bridle of the Mother City out of the hand of the Philistines.

2 And he struck Moab, and measured them with a line; making them to lie down on the ground. And he measured two lines to cause them to die, and the fulness of the line to keep alive. And the Moabites were slaves to David, bearing a gift.

3 And David struck Hadadezer the son of Rehob, king of Zobah, as he went to restore his power at the River.

People & Context

David

King who defeats the Philistines, Moab, Hadadezer, and Syria, then orders his kingdom

Hadadezer

King of Zobah, son of Rehob, whose army David strikes and whose spoil David dedicates

Toi

King of Hamath who sends gifts to bless David for defeating his enemy Hadadezer

Joram

Son of Toi sent to greet David with articles of silver, gold, and bronze

Joab

Son of Zeruiah, set over David's army

Benaiah

Son of Jehoiada, set over the Cherethites and the Pelethites

Timeline

Victory Over the Philistines

David strikes and humbles the Philistines, taking the Bridle of the Mother City out of their hands.

2 Samuel 8:1
Victory Over Moab

David strikes Moab, measures the people with a line to kill two-thirds and keep one-third alive, and makes the Moabites his servants who bring gifts.

2 Samuel 8:2
Victory Over Zobah

David strikes Hadadezer king of Zobah, captures massive amounts of troops and chariots, and hamstrings most of the chariot horses.

2 Samuel 8:3-4
